Cloud ERP for Product Centric Company Market Restraints Analysis

Despite the strong growth drivers, the Cloud ERP for Product Centric Company market faces certain restraints that could temper its expansion. One significant hurdle is the persistent concern over data security and privacy, particularly for sensitive business information and intellectual property related to product design and manufacturing processes. Companies are hesitant to migrate critical data to the cloud without robust assurances of data protection, compliance with regional regulations (like GDPR or CCPA), and transparent security protocols from cloud ERP providers.

Another major restraint is the potentially high initial implementation costs and the complexities associated with migrating existing legacy systems to a new cloud-based ERP platform. This often involves significant data migration challenges, integration with disparate systems, and substantial training requirements for employees, leading to disruption during the transition period. Additionally, the availability of skilled IT professionals proficient in cloud ERP implementation and management remains a bottleneck, particularly in emerging markets, slowing down adoption rates for some enterprises.

Cloud ERP for Product Centric Company Market Challenges Impact Analysis

The Cloud ERP for Product Centric Company market faces several formidable challenges that require strategic navigation from both vendors and adopting enterprises. A primary challenge is the complexity of data migration from disparate legacy systems to a unified cloud ERP platform. This process often involves cleaning, transforming, and transferring vast amounts of historical data, which can be time-consuming, prone to errors, and disruptive to ongoing operations if not meticulously planned and executed. Ensuring data integrity and consistency throughout this transition is critical for the success of the new system.

Another significant challenge is managing organizational change resistance. Employees accustomed to traditional workflows and existing systems may be reluctant to adopt new processes and technologies, leading to lower user adoption rates and sub-optimal utilization of the new ERP system. Effective change management strategies, including comprehensive training and clear communication, are essential to overcome this hurdle. Furthermore, vendor lock-in remains a concern, where companies become overly reliant on a single vendor's ecosystem, limiting flexibility and potentially leading to higher long-term costs. Navigating diverse regulatory and compliance landscapes across different regions also adds layers of complexity, requiring cloud ERP solutions to be highly adaptable and compliant.

What is Cloud ERP for Product Centric Companies?

Cloud ERP for product-centric companies refers to enterprise resource planning software hosted on remote servers and accessed via the internet, specifically designed to manage the unique operations of businesses that design, manufacture, distribute, and sell physical products. This includes functionalities for product lifecycle management, supply chain optimization, manufacturing processes, inventory, and sales, all delivered as a service.

Why are product-centric companies shifting to Cloud ERP?

Product-centric companies are shifting to Cloud ERP to gain enhanced scalability, flexibility, and cost efficiency compared to traditional on-premise systems. Cloud solutions provide real-time data access, improve supply chain visibility, facilitate global collaboration, and support rapid product innovation, which are critical for navigating complex and competitive markets.

What are the primary benefits of Cloud ERP for manufacturing companies?

The primary benefits for manufacturing companies include improved production planning and scheduling, optimized inventory management, enhanced quality control, better supply chain collaboration, reduced IT infrastructure costs, and greater agility to adapt to market changes. It also supports better data analytics for predictive maintenance and demand forecasting.

What are the main challenges in implementing Cloud ERP for product businesses?

Key challenges include ensuring data security and privacy for sensitive product information, managing complex data migration from legacy systems, integrating with existing disparate software, addressing potential vendor lock-in, and overcoming internal resistance to organizational change. Proper planning and expertise are essential to mitigate these issues.
